Overview

Set sail for adventure in J. Fenimore Cooper's ""Mercedes of Castile: The Voyage to Cathay,"" a captivating work of historical fiction. Journey back to the Age of Exploration and witness the reign of Ferdinand and Isabella in Spain, brought to life through Cooper's meticulous prose. This meticulously researched historical novel delves into a pivotal era of Spanish history, exploring the political climate and societal forces that shaped the nation. While the story unfolds as fiction, its core is steeped in the historical context of Spain during the reign of Ferdinand and Isabella, offering readers a glimpse into the world of Christopher Columbus and the ambitious voyages that defined the age. ""Mercedes of Castile"" remains a testament to Cooper's skill as a storyteller and his dedication to historical accuracy. Experience the drama and intrigue of a bygone era in this classic tale.
